As the Weighbridge Coordinator, you will be responsible for general office coordination and assist in administrative tasks relating to the weighbridge.
Please note, this role will be working across 5 days a week from 1pm - 5pm (4hrs) Mon-Fri
About the role:
- Coordination and reconciliation of weighbridge documentation
- Ensuring all vehicles entering the site are captured and identified in weighbridge control systems
- Investigating error logs, with councils and other customers
- Reconcile incoming weighbridge invoices.
- Tracking, recording, and checking containers loads and entering details into the system
- Maintain accurate recording and identification of incoming/outgoing loads/containers and vehicle details
- Booking and preparing dispatch/ received paperwork for transport companies
- Liaising with drivers, outsource providers, transport companies and plant operators daily
- Schedule, track and ensure all customer deliveries are completed in a timely manner
- Completing daily/weekly/monthly weighbridge reports
- Compiling weekly weighbridge in & out tonnage for the accounts department
- Compiling Monthly RCTI report for Account Payable to make payment
- Participation in safety initiatives including pre-starts, toolboxes, and incident reporting
- Supervise the operation of all weighbridge equipment to ensure efficient bin handling
